This is a 1953 Maserati A6GCS/53 Spyder by Fantuzzi – just 52 of them were built in 1953 by Maserati with the sole aim of challenging the likes of Ferrari, Jaguar and Mercedes-Benz on some of the most iconic race tracks in Europe and around the world.

This is Mike “The Bike” Hailwood racing at the 1978 Isle of Man TT, it was Hailwood’s comeback race and no one expected him to even place in the top 3 – after having spent 11 years away from the world of competitive motorcycle racing.

This incredible Ural Racer is a creation from the mind of Joao Alves, it’s based on a stock 2013 Ural Solo sT but I think you’ll agree, the finished bike looks like a totally new creature. Joao has given the Ural Racer a beautiful mid-70s fairing, a studded cafe racer seat, a 2-into-2 chopped exhaust, a set of clip-on handlebars and an entirely new personality.

ODFU is one of our favourite boutique motorcycle clothing companies, its founder is a friendly guy by the name of Kevin Wilson who like many of us, loves motorcycles. “ODFU” actually stands for “one down five up” – the transmission layout on a standard motorcycle.
